Output ea95111233856eb230f84b1b7797f6b942ae15c2929c7826c148722423a73512:0

value
333333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 545f4fe03eaad25df51105bc64e3e1e25c537a02 OP_EQUAL
address
39P8s3zfZZLoaCvV754eEzNn1PeQCJX7ZB
transaction
ea95111233856eb230f84b1b7797f6b942ae15c2929c7826c148722423a73512
spent
true